A study of sexual variation in Indian femur.

Ruma Purkait1, Heeresh Chandra.   

Abstract

Assessment of sex from femoral dimensions have been tried before in several populations. Studies conducted so far have demonstrated that populations differ from one another in size and proportion. Therefore, the discriminant formulae developed for determining sex for one population group cannot be applied on another. As to date no detailed study of femur on the subject has been reported from India, an attempt has been made in the present study to examine the sexual dimorphism in femur of Indian origin using 124 femora from central India. Eleven standard dimensions were measured on the bones. The data were analysed using discriminant function procedures and the results of different measurements are reported independently and in various combinations. Maximum head diameter alone could correctly assign sex to 92.5% of males and 95.5% of females. Evaluation of the discriminating ability of the variables selected in stepwise analysis are then conducted using cross validation procedure. To understand the population variation, the discriminant formula derived from Thai, Chinese, South African white, American black and white were applied on the present sample. The comparison indicated that Indians have very different dimension from South African whites and American whites. Their dimensions are more closer to Thais and Chinese but in no way identical to them.
